Mr Fluffy Head is a very fluffy guinea pig and he is 3 months old.

Sadly there are more male guinea pigs in rescue centres as they are more likely to fall out when kept in boar pairs that are not well matched, and they are social animals that do not like to live alone. So Mr Fluffy Head has had the snip and we have adopted him, he now has 2 wives who do rather boss him about!  They live in an enclosure in the lounge and come out for exercise and cuddles.  His favourite foods are lettuce and pea flakes, and his favourite place to hide is in his box full of hay.   We are unsure what type Mr Fluffy Head is but he does appear to be one of the long haired breeds, as his hair is getting longer and longer!

Guinea pigs (Cavia porcellus) have been domesticated for 3000 years, originally for meat. They were introduced as pets in the UK in Victorian times, and many differently types have been selectively bred.   They no longer have a direct equivalent in the wild, though related species live in the savannahs of South America.
